Mesogen-Free Supramolecular Liquid Crystalline State Formed by a Polyelectrolyte/Amphiphile Complex
2005
The microstructure and phase transformation of a highly-branched polyethyleneimine/octadecanoic acid (PEI(OA) 1 . 0 ) complex were investigated using a combination of DSC, XRD, optical polarised microscopy and temperaturedependent FT-IR spectroscopy. A mesogen-free thermotropic liquid crystalline state was observed in a certain temperature region. The strong ionic interaction between -COO- (from OA) and -NH + 3 (from PEI) and the hydrophobic interaction between the alkyl side chains contributes to the formation of a thermotropic liquid crystalline structure.
